- واژهنامه · Merriam-Webster Collegiate Dictionary in·can·ta·tion n. Pronunciation: ˌ in- ˌ kan- ' tā-shən Function: noun Etymology: Middle English incantacioun, from Middle French incantation, from Late Latin incantation-, incantatio, from Latin incantare to enchant ― more at ENCHANT Date: 14th century : a use of spells or verbal charms spoken or sung as a part of a ritual of magic also : a written or recited formula of words designed to produce a particular effect –in·can·ta·tion·al \-shnəl, -shə-n ə l\ adjective –in·can·ta·to·ry \in- ' kan-tə- ˌ tōr-ē, - ˌ to ̇ r-\ adjective ]]>
